Maintaining appropriate pH levels in drinking water primarily serves to minimize corrosion within the water distribution system and plumbing fixtures. When pH levels are too low (acidic), they can lead to increased corrosion of pipes and fixtures, which can release harmful metals such as lead and copper into the drinking water supply. A stable pH level helps to create a protective coating inside pipes, reducing the rate of corrosion and extending the longevity of the infrastructure.

While pH can affect taste, with excessively high or low levels potentially leading to undesirable flavors, this is not the primary concern for water treatment facilities. Similarly, bacteria control and mineral levels are important aspects of water quality, but they are not directly managed through pH adjustments in the same way as corrosion prevention. Thus, ensuring a balanced pH level is crucial for the health and safety of drinking water systems, making the goal of minimizing corrosion the most relevant focus.
